Rule of thumb, I NEVER do a straight up deal with a big time hitter for a pitcher. Hitters are everyday players, pitchers start once every 5 days. You do need pitching but losing Wright would be a major issue. I have Chris Johnson also but who knows when he starts to tank. I might look to do a package deal where you get back a hitter and a pitcher.
